The SE-PH2 photocells are designed to detect obstacles in auto-
matic door and gate installations, preventing collision with the door
/gate. They are made up of an infrared transmitter module (TX) and
receiver module (RX). If a person or object interrupts the beam of light
emitted by transmitter (TX) (or the beam does not reach the receiver
due tofailure or loss of setting), the receiver (RX) enables the corre-
sponding relay and informs the installation control unit.

1) Install the receiver (RX) keep away from direct sunlight
    (infrared radiation).
2) Choose a location for the transmitter and receiver equipment.
     The two modules should be as aligned as possible.

3) The installation height of photocells will depend on the installation
     (in general, we recommend installation at a height of less than
     300mm from the ground and at a distance of less than 200mm
     from the leaf of the gate).
4) Connect the electrical power supply. When the receiver correctly
     receives the beam sent by transmitter, the NC contact remains

     closed and LED light off. When the beam is interrupted, the NC

     contact opensand LED light on.

J1 (LONG): range between 10m and 30m
J1 (NORMAL): range less than 10m
J2 (1-2): less sensitivity to avoid snow and rain weather
J2 (2-3): more sensitivity to detect obstacle
